31-year-old under influence whacks 75-year-old father to death
A man in Song LGA, Adamawa, has been arrested for his 75-year-old father to death.
Nicodemus Ignatius, 31, committed the crime after returning home from a drinking binge on March 3.
That was the second time Ignatiius would make such attempt, following that of November which got him arrested.
According to neighbours, he first locked both his father and mother up that day.
The frightened old man however attempted to escape by jumping through a window.
Ignatiius then descended on him, and whacked him with a stick.
On his arrest, the suspect confessed to killing his father, saying he was under the influence of marijuana.
DSP Suleiman Nguroje, Police Public Relations Officer, Adamawa State Police Command, who confirmed the incident, said the suspect would soon be charged to court.
